    guidelines how to issue a proposal. You represent a small team who wants to jointly conduct research on POLARSTERN? In this case, you can submit a proposal for secondary use. The number of team members should not [...] may submit a proposal for main use. You should though, bear in mind that the planning period for POLARSTERN corresponds to 3 years. Since autumn 2017, a review panel, ”Gutachterpanel Forschungsschiffe” (GPF) [...] (GPF), organizes the review and evaluation of the proposals for ship time on RV POLARSTERN and HEINCKE. The GPF has the mandate to evaluate the proposals for German research vessels and to make recommendations
